Output 6640492dcae1cafbc1718f028bf9ccdf72008742ca931966f19d90ac0100373b:2

value
1379332
script pubkey
OP_0 OP_PUSHBYTES_20 5ab4ebba250cf4eb8bfb5845e2d5334846ecd7f7
address
bc1qt26whw39pn6whzlmtpz794fnfprwe4lhzmpkxx
transaction
6640492dcae1cafbc1718f028bf9ccdf72008742ca931966f19d90ac0100373b
spent
true